"Hello, Hello" is a song featured on the Touchstone Pictures film, Gnomeo & Juliet. it was written by John and Bernie Taupin, and sung by Elton John and Lady Gaga.

Trivia

  • The duet of John and Lady Gaga for "Hello, Hello" was featured in the film, but the soundtrack version only has John.
